diff options
-rw-r--r-- | engines/drascula/sound.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/engines/drascula/sound.cpp b/engines/drascula/sound.cpp index 51517280ba..41bebdbe59 100644 --- a/engines/drascula/sound.cpp +++ b/engines/drascula/sound.cpp @@ -72,6 +72,10 @@ void DrasculaEngine::volumeControls() { updateEvents(); + // we're ignoring keypresses, so just empty the keyboard buffer + while (getScan()) + ; + if (rightMouseButton == 1) { delay(100); break; |